Моделирование бизнеса. Методология ARIS


• степени обобщения и детализации разрабатываемых моделей;

• количества уровней моделей, представляющих переход от общих моделей к детальным.

Первый пункт связан с целями и задачами моделирования. Например, для внедрения информационной системы необходимо описание до уровня рабочих мест или даже до уровня операций на рабочих местах с построением моделей структур данных и т. п.

Второй пункт связан с необходимостью получения наглядных моделей, не перегруженных информацией. Для определения глубины моделирования вводится понятие иерархических и неиерархических моделей.


Иерархические модели — это модели, ко торые отражают подчинение объектов одного типа другому. К ним относятся диаграмма целей, дерево функций, организационная схема и другие. Для этих типов моделей необходимо определить количество отражаемых на одной диаграмме уровней иерархии. Как правило, диаграммы более чем с четырьмя или пятью уровнями иерархии становятся плохо читаемыми и тяжелыми для восприятия, а аккуратное размещение объектов в поле модели — проблематичным.

Для уменьшения количества уровней на одной диаграмме используется механизм детализации: объекты четвертого или пятого уровней детализируются моделью того же типа, где и отражаются последующие 4-5 уровней иерархии (рис. 187).



Рис. 187. Иерархические модели


Неиерархические модели — это модели, которые отражают взаимосвязь объектов одного уровня. К ним можно отнести модели процессов VAD, eEPC, PCD и другие. В этом случае необходимо управлять степенью загруженности модели — чем меньшее количество уровней используется, тем более детальными, а значит, и загруженными получаются модели.

Таким образом, формируется карта иерархии моделей — переход от моделей верхнего уровня обобщения к детальным моделям. Пример такой карты представлен на рис. 188.